This volume covers data structures, searching techniques, jojnsonbaugh sorting and selection, greedy algorithms, dynamic programming, text searching, computational algebra, P and NP and parallel algorithms.
Methods used to solve NP-complete problems —Including approximation, brute force, parameterized complexity, and heuristics.
